Carol Ann Webster, age 67, of Rhinelander, died on August 7, 2019 at the Friendly Village Nursing Home, in Rhinelander. She was born on April 25, 1952, in Rhinelander to William and Sarah (Uttecht) Lex.

Carol was raised in Rhinelander and attended schools here, graduating from the Rhinelander High School in 1970. She married Bradley Webster and they were blessed with two sons Ronald and Daniel. Besides raising the boys Carol had also worked at a number of different locations which included Rhinelander Well Drilling, EZ Rental, US Stick and the Ripco Credit Union. When she had free time she really enjoyed fishing and ice fishing. She would fish everything from panfish to Salmon. Carol also had an artistic side as she enjoyed painting and woodworking.

Carol is survived by her sons Ronald (Margo) Webster of Pardeeville, WI and Daniel (Brooke) Webster of Poynette, WI, her five grandchildren, Hunter, Alyssa, Jolan, Kaelyn and Andrew and her brother Dennis (Jeannie) Lex of Boston, a niece, nephews, other family and many friends. She was preceded in death by her parents and her sister Mary Bishop.
